According to the public record, 191, Oldham Road, Ashton-Under-Lyne is a mid-century freehold house with 1,076 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 95.1 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 191, Oldham Road, Ashton-Under-Lyne is £189,845 and the estimated rental value is £1,092 per month.
Oldham Road, Ashton-Under-Lyne, OL7 is located in the borough of Tameside within the OL7 postal district.
191, Oldham Road, Ashton-Under-Lyne has a single entry in the Land Registry from December 2021 and a single entry in the EPC database dated January 2026.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 191, Oldham Road, Ashton-Under-Lyne is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£199,337 and a rental value of £1,146 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£176,556 and a rental value of £1,015 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 191 Oldham Road Ashton-Under-Lyne has increased by an estimated £5,293 (2.8%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£34 per month (3.1%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.9%.

191, Oldham Road, Ashton-Under-Lyne has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 05 Jan 2026.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 191, Oldham Road, Ashton-Under-Lyne was last sold on 7th December 2021 for £180,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since December 2021, the market for similar properties has risen 23.6%
